(17)\n25-1110\nCD 11\nCATEGORICAL EXEMPTION and PLANNING AND LAND USE\nMANAGEMENT COMMITTEE REPORT relative to the inclusion of\nSiegel House, located at 12400 West Deerbrook Lane, in the list of\nHistoric-Cultural Monuments.\nRecommendations for Council action:\n1. DETERMINE that the proposed designation is\ncategorically exempt from the California Environmental\nQuality Act (CEQA), pursuant to Article 19, Section 15308,\nClass 8 and Article 19, Section 15331, Class 31 of the\nState CEQA Guidelines.\n2. DETERMINE that the subject property conforms with the\ndefinition of a Monument pursuant to Section 22.171.7 of\nthe Los Angeles Administrative Code.\n3. ADOPT the FINDINGS of the Cultural\nCommission (CHC) as the Findings of Council.\nHeritage\n4. APPROVE the recommendations of the CHC relative to\nthe inclusion of Siegel House, located at 12400 West\nDeerbrook Lane, in the list of Historic-Cultural\nMonuments.\nApplicant: Cory Buckner, Architect\nOwners: James Sewell and Natasha Wellesley Miller\nCase No. CHC-2025-3531-HCM\nEnvironmental No. ENV-2025-3532-CE\nFiscal Impact Statement: None submitted by the CHC. Neither the\nCity Administrative Officer nor the Chief Legislative Analyst has\ncompleted a financial analysis of this report.
